Waterproofed the basement by installing the Grate Drain system , which is a perimeter, sub floor drainage system. The Level Two Ground Water Control system was also installed, which features a closed sump system and a water alarm. Thermal Finish Shield was installed to create a vapor barrier and protect against mold and mildew. These systems will stop all water leakage the customer was previously experiencing and prevent this from happening in the future.

Installed Grate Drain perimeter system and the Level Two Ground Water Control system. The level two system features a closed sump system, water alarm, and more. Thermal Finish Shield was installed to seal off wall and protect against moisture, mold, and mildew. A Crack injection was also performed to permanently seal crack and prevent it from leaking in the future.
